Abstract

Percutaneous coronary intervention (PCI) of chronic total occlusion (CTO) is the last frontier in coronary intervention. PCI of CTO carries multiple advantages, such as significant improvement in symptoms, improvement in abnormal wall motion and left ventricular function and, possibly, increased long-term survival. As of today the procedural success is markedly improved because of technical innovations and is limited to highly experienced operators. To enhance the overall success rate from a worldwide perspective, a thorough understanding of its pathophysiology is critical to further development of newer techniques and technologies. In this review, the author outlines in-depth the evidence that underpins our understanding of CTO pathophysiology and its insight into CTO intervention that incorporates various steps and techniques to cross the lesion.

摘要

慢性完全闭塞病变(CTO)的经皮冠状动脉介入治疗(PCI)是冠状动脉介入治疗的最后一个前沿领域。CTO的PCI具有多种优势,如症状显著改善、异常室壁运动和左心室功能改善,以及可能提高长期生存率。截至目前,由于技术创新,手术成功率显著提高,但仅限于经验丰富的术者。从全球角度提高总体成功率,深入了解其病理生理学对于新技术和技术的进一步发展至关重要。在这篇综述中,作者深入概述了支撑我们对CTO病理生理学理解的证据,以及其对CTO介入治疗的见解,该治疗纳入了跨越病变的各种步骤和技术。
